If there is a KSM 2, it is because there is a KSM 1. Both differs only by visualization of the value of the diaphragm in the viewfinder of the KSM 2.
The two models are with mounting Pentax K, from where this K at the beginning of their name. They are semi-automatic cameras, whose measure of exposure is provided by two CdS cells. Posting in the viewfinder is made by means of three diodes (on the right side). In a very usual way, green indicates the correct exposure, whereas the reds indicate up and under-exposure.
The focusing is facilitated by a rangefinder with crossed fields with horizontal break, surrounded by a crown of microprisms.
These cameras are motorisables thanks to the Auto--Winder EX (recocking and non motor).
There exists also one Carena KS, more economic version, not motorisable and whose viewfinder does not comprise a rangefinder with cross fields.
The KSM 1 and KSM 2 are in black completion, whereas the KS exists only in chrome completion.
It is about a Cosina manufacture.
